I've got it - #55 and #57, and I have them on order.  Fortunate timing, as all issues before 55 - and many after, are sold out. 

Also, Roy is working on a new book - 'WDLR Album' - with previously unseen War Department photos from March of 1918 showing the train in operation, among other things; hopefully due out next year, but not certain.  Another source mentioned that a lot of new WDLR material is "coming to light".
